Trained in Biology, University of Utrecht (Utrecht, NL) (BS) and in microbial ecology and risk assessment, Wageningen University (Wageningen, NL), worked at RIKILT – Institute for Food Safety (Wageningen, NL, 2007-2010), National Institute for Public Health and the Environment (RIVM, NL, 2010-)10-) where I am head (2016-) of Department Epidemiology and Surveillance of Gastroenteritis and Zoonoses.
My research mainly focus on:
- Genomics for public health, surveillance and outbreak management
- Epidemiology of gastrointestinal pathogens, tick-borne pathogens and AMR
Role in Syst-OMICS
In collaboration with France daigle, I’m involved in Activity 1.4 which aims to assess survival, pathogenicity and virulence gene expression of Salmonella in a simulated gastrointestinal model. This is performed by Dr. Lucas Wijnands at the RIVM centre for Zoonoses and Environmental Microbiology. My role is the coupling to genomics and epidemiology.
